HOW DATA IS USED & STORED

TPZ uses connected identity and security data to identify risk, calculate posture, generate findings, and support the views you see in the product.

Analyze and prioritize security risk

ANALYZE & PRIORITIZE

TPZ analyzes connected data to identify security concerns, calculate risk and posture indicators, and generate findings and recommendations.

Encrypted customer data storage

ENCRYPTED STORAGE

Customer data used by TPZ is stored in encrypted AWS infrastructure. TPZ stores normalized identity, role, application, policy, score, and sign-in information needed to power the product.

Organization-scoped customer data

ORGANIZATION-SCOPED

Customer data is scoped to the organization it belongs to and separated from other TPZ customer environments.

Securely separated connection credentials

SECRETS STORED SEPARATELY

Connection credentials and other secrets are handled separately through AWS Secrets Manager rather than being stored as plaintext in the TPZ application database.

Optional AI assistant data processing

OPTIONAL AI ASSISTANT

When the AI Assistant is used, TPZ sends the conversation and a limited dashboard snapshot to the AI provider. The full identity directory is not automatically included. Chat history is kept in the browser session rather than stored in TPZ’s database.

SECURITY & DATA

Security & Compliance

TPZ uses technical and operational controls to protect customer data and the systems that process it.

ENCRYPTED INFRASTRUCTURE

Customer data stored by TPZ is encrypted at rest within AWS infrastructure.

ORGANIZATION-SCOPED ACCESS

Customer data is associated with the organization it belongs to, with authentication and authorization controls used to separate access across TPZ customer environments.

CREDENTIAL PROTECTION

Connection credentials, API keys, and other secrets are managed separately through AWS Secrets Manager rather than stored as plaintext in the application database. Microsoft access tokens are held in memory rather than persisted in the TPZ database.

SECURITY MONITORING

TPZ maintains application, infrastructure, and edge logs for security monitoring and troubleshooting.

COMPLIANCE & ASSURANCE

TPZ is currently working toward SOC 2 assurance. TPZ does not represent itself as SOC 2 compliant or as having completed a SOC 2 examination.
